2. The Alchemy of Atlantis: the "Mission Brief" of the<br />

Kammler stab<br />

But what do all these fantastic projects indicate about the nature<br />

of German secret weapons research We may draw a number of<br />

conclusions from the evidence presented thus far, and in so doing,<br />

speculatively reconstruct the "mission briefing" of the secret<br />

weapons think tank being run by Kammler's SS Sonderkommando:<br />

(1) Overlapping technologies were to be developed that could<br />

be employed in across a wide variety of various weapons<br />

systems (Stealth and RAM technology, etc);<br />

(2) Every available method for the creation of prototypical<br />

"smart weapons" was to be pursed (wire, radio, and<br />

television-guidance systems), i.e., German technological and<br />

engineering competence were to be exploited to the<br />

maximum;<br />

(3) This technological competence was to be pursued in (then)<br />

unconventional ways and combinations to create not only<br />

new weapons, but a new doctrine of warfare;<br />

(4) The first generation of these weapons were then to be<br />

extrapolated upon, and second and third generation<br />

technology trees and long range goals mapped out;<br />

(5) The ultimate quest was for the attainment of weapons of<br />

mass destruction beyond the acquisition of atomic and<br />

thermonuclear weapons;<br />

(6) Post-nuclear systems were then to be developed ideally, and<br />

initial research on those systems undertaken; and finally, as<br />

we shall see,<br />

(7) Every known theoretical principle of physics was to be<br />

pondered and extrapolations for weaponization theorized,<br />

and, to the extent possible, experimented upon and utilized.<br />

In other words, the Kammlerstab's mission brief was to think<br />

"outside the box" entirely, even if that meant outside the box of<br />

Nazi party ideology, or, when it suited it, inside it. The basis was<br />

the will to power, by whatever means possible.<br />
